Typical Problems with Conservatory Roofs
[conservatory renovation](http://bbs.abcdv.net/home.php?mod=space&uid=664550) roofing systems are available in various products, such as glass, polycarbonate, or tile. Each material has its own strengths and obstacles. With time, they can experience wear and tear, which may lead to numerous issues, including:
1. Leaks
One of the most typical issues related to [conservatory roof Repair](http://www.optionshare.tw/home.php?mod=space&uid=3588272) roofs is leaking. Water seepage can be triggered by damaged seals, broken panels, or improper setup.
2. Condensation
Insufficient ventilation or extreme humidity can result in condensation forming on the roof. This can create an uneasy environment and potentially damage furnishings or other personal belongings placed in the conservatory.
3. Damage to Panels
Whether from falling debris, hail, or general wear, conservatory panels can end up being broken or shattered, demanding replacement.
4. Structural Issues
With time, the frame of a conservatory may settle or warp, causing misaligned panels or weakening of the structure, which can lead to leaks and drafts.
5. UV Damage
UV rays can deteriorate the integrity of both glass and polycarbonate roofings. This damage can result in discoloration, loss of insulation, and fragility in the products.
Repair Techniques for Conservatory Roofs
Repairing a conservatory roof can vary in intricacy, depending on the concern. Here are some typical repair options:
For Leaking Roofs:
Inspect Seals and Gaskets:
Check the stability of seals and gaskets. If damaged, these must be changed.
Tidy Debris:
Ensure seamless gutters and drain channels are clear to prevent water build-up.
Seal Cracks/Spaces:
Use roof sealants to fill any fractures particularly around joints or edges.For Condensation:
Improve Ventilation:
Install vents or windows that can be opened to boost airflow.
Use Dehumidifiers:
Invest in a dehumidifier to regulate wetness levels inside the conservatory.
Insulate the Roof:
Consider setting up insulated panels that can assist lessen temperature level fluctuations.For Damaged Panels:
Replace Glass or Polycarbonate:
If a panel is split, replacing it is typically the best alternative. Care must be taken to match the material and density.
Repair Rather than Replace:
Small cracks in some materials can frequently be fixed using particular adhesives.For Structural Issues:
Reinforce Frame:
If the frame is compromised, including extra assistances may be needed.
Re-align Panels:
Ensure that all panels are correctly lined up to prevent leaks.
Speak with a Professional:
In cases of serious structural damage, working with a specialist with conservatory experience is advisable.Maintenance Tips to Prevent Repairs

Q: How much does it cost to repair a conservatory roof?A: The cost can differ significantly depending on the extent of the damage and the type of products utilized. Small repairs might range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, while significant repairs or panel replacements could cost upwards of ₤ 1,500.

Q: Can I repair a conservatory roof myself?A: Many minor repairs can be performed by handy homeowners. Nevertheless, for substantial issues, specifically those including structural stability or numerous panel replacements, it's best to consult a professional. Q: How often should I maintain my conservatory roof?A: It's advisable to check and keep your conservatory
roof a minimum of two times a year, ideally in spring and fall, to ensure it stays in excellent condition. Q: What type of product is best for a conservatory roof?A: Each roofing material has its benefits. Glass provides excellent natural light and aesthetic appeals, while polycarbonate is light-weight and supplies better insulation. Ultimately, the best material depends upon the house owner's needs, budget plan, and regional environment.
